Hi Belle,  

I’m trying to find a structured, black, leather satchel that’s appropriate for work. Currently, all of the bags I own are either too large (tote-sized) or too small (clutches) to carry to work on a daily basis.  I have a birthday coming up and would like to splurge on a nicer bag, preferably under $400. 

Any suggestions or recommendations?  Thank you! -A

I’m a sucker for a satchel.  Here are a few medium-large satchels that make excellent work bags.

rsz_1screen_shot_2014-01-20_at_93809_amRalph Lauren Taylor Satchel ($268) // Minkoff Mini MAB Satchel ($395) // Folli Follie K Satchel ($225)

In the $200 to $300 range, this Ralph Lauren satchel and this Folli Follie satchel are both excellent choices.  The Lauren satchel has three pockets for keeping organized, if you need some help in that area.  Also, if this size is a bit too large for you, the Folli satchel comes in a smaller size.

On the top end of the price range is the Minkoff Mini MAB.  This might be the best handbag that I have ever purchased.  It wears well, looks great and is a true classic.  I also like this Minkoff Amorous satchel for its unique shape, and this Marc Jacobs satchel with a detachable body strap.

Need something under-$125?  J.Crew Factory has this lovely Dorset satchel, and Jessica Simpson has this distinguished-looking Hadley satchel.  And I like the look of this nylon Steve Madden satchel.

Dear Belle,

On your suggestion, I bought a khaki trench two years ago.  I love it, but I’d like a dark one for variety.  Can you help me find one in black or navy?  I’d even consider gray as long as it’s not light gray.  My price range is under $300.

Thanks! Savannah

This Ellen Tracy trench comes in all the colors that you’re looking for and costs under-$100.  This black Michael Kors trench has a slightly military look to it, which gives it a modern edge.  And this black DKNY trench’s classic look comes in regular and petite.

If it’s navy you’re after, this ASOS classic trench is a great choice at $111.  As for the grey, this Via Spiga trench is a good place to start.

Also, this is a bit off topic, but someone asked for single-breasted trenches last week.  If that’s what you’re after, check out this Gallery trench with detachable hood and this inexpensive London Fog trench.

For plus-size, this Michael Kors coat is a good choice, as is this Kristen Blake coat.  Petite? The Ellen Tracy trench mentioned above comes in your size.  And if you’re tall, try Banana Republic.

Belle,

I’ve focused the past year on professional clothing and shoes and have found myself woefully devoid of acceptable flats. I had a great pair of black semi-flats (similar look to these here) but I’m having trouble finding a good replacement pair.

While we are discussing flats, I would love a recommendation for brown/tortoise shell flats. I wear my tortoise shell pumps a good bit and always get compliments, I’d love something that I could wear on casual work days or on the weekends. 

I love your blog! Lizzie

Sliver wedges aren’t as popular this year as they probably were when you bought your shoes, but I found these Figure It Out flats at DSW.  I also like these Splendid ankle strap flats.  Pointed-toe flats are my preference because they make legs look longer, so I’d also look at these toe-cap Michael Kors flats and these under-$50 Dolce Vita d’orsay flats.

As for the tortoise flats, they can be tough to find.  These tasselled flats from Sperry were the only ones that I could find that aren’t priced like Manolos.  But if you like wedges, I’d check out these Taryn Rose peep toe wedges in tortoise.

Hi Belle,

I just moved to humid Seattle from Wyoming, do you have a favorite hairspray to combat the moisture in the air?  My curls are frizzing and falling at the same time.  

xo, Elise

My favorite hairspray is Big Sexy Play Harder Spray.  I’d also give DryBar Money Maker flexible hold a shot, if you’re looking for something in the mid-hold range.  And if you need a drugstore brand, you need Freeze-It.
